✨Know Your Geography Inside Out

Make sure you brush up on key geographical concepts and current events related to the subject. Being able to discuss recent developments or case studies will show your passion and expertise, which is exactly what they’re looking for.

✨Showcase Your Teaching Style

Prepare to discuss your teaching methods and how you engage students in learning. Think of specific examples where you've successfully taught a challenging topic or inspired students to love geography. This will demonstrate your ability to fit into their collaborative culture.

✨Research the School's Values

Familiarise yourself with the school's mission and values. During the interview, relate your personal teaching philosophy to their goals. This shows that you’re not just a good teacher, but also a great cultural fit for their team.

✨Ask Thoughtful Questions

Prepare some insightful questions about the Geography Department and the support they offer. This not only shows your interest in the role but also helps you gauge if this is the right environment for your professional development.
